Cranial Nerves & Infant Digestion
Feb 24, 2026
Cranial Nerves & Infant Digestion
Feb 24, 2026

For many parents, infant digestion issues like constipation, colic, or feeding difficulties can feel mysterious and frustrating. But when we look closely at how digestion is wired into your baby’s tiny nervous system, the picture becomes much clearer. The cranial nerves, a set of 12 nerves emerging directly from the brain, play critical roles not just in simple reflexes like crying or breathing, but in how your baby feeds, swallows, and moves food through the digestive tract.
